An early inspection is advised on this individual detached home, finished to a high specification comprising open plan kitchen/breakfast room, sitting room, cloak room, study, galleried landing, four bedrooms, ensuite shower room and bathroom. There is off road parking leading to the detached double garage and enclosed garden.

Kitchen/Breakfast Room23'2" x 16'2" (7.06m x 4.93m). Open plan to sitting room, kitchen area with Bespoke range of Walnut base units with solid Acacia working surfaces over and matching wall units, stainless steel sink and drainer, integrated fridge and dishwasher, built in eye level double electric oven, Island unit with built in microwave, five ring gas hob with suspended canopy extractor over, spot lighting, marble tiled walls and floor, rear aspect double glazed window, television point, breakfast area with double glazed doors to garden, marble tiled floor and spot lighting.

Sitting Room21' x 15'6" (6.4m x 4.72m). Triple aspect double glazed windows, feature exposed floor, television point and spot lighting.

Utility Room9'6" x 8' (2.9m x 2.44m). Double glazed window to the side, fitted with a range of Walnut base units with marble tiled splash backs, stainless steel sink and drainer, plumbing for washing machine, space for tumble dryer, wall mounted gas fired boiler providing underfloor heating to the ground floor and traditional central heating to the first floor and domestic hot water, spot lighting and marble tiled floor.

Inner Hall15'10" x 7'4" (4.83m x 2.24m). Stairs to first floor, side aspect double glazed window, marble tiled floor and door to.

Cloak Room7'9" x 4'9" (2.36m x 1.45m). Side aspect double glazed window, suite comprising low level WC, wash hand basin, marble tiled floor and walls, heated towel rail and extractor fan.

study12'10" x 8'4" (3.91m x 2.54m). Front and side aspect double glazed windows, feature exposed teak floor and spot lighting.

Galleried landing Feature exposed teak floor, airing cupboard with hot water cylinder and additional tank for solar heating, Velux roof light window, radiator and doors to:

Master bedroom22' x 12'10" (6.7m x 3.91m). Built in wardrobe with cupboard over,feature exposed teak floor, rear and side aspect double glazed windows, Velux roof light, radiator, television point and spot lighting.

ensuite Suite comprising tiled shower cubicle, low level WC, wash hand basin, marble tiled floor and walls, shaver point, spot lighting, towel rail and underfloor heating.

bedroom two13'8" x 12'10" (4.17m x 3.91m). Front aspect double glazed window, two side aspect double glazed Velux windows, Teak floor, radiator, spot lighting television point and sloping ceilings.

bedroom three21' x 7'8" (6.4m x 2.34m). Side aspect double glazed window with views to Beeston Bump in the distance, Velux window to front, radiator, spot lighting, television point and range of base units with working surfaces over.

bedroom four21' x 7'8" (6.4m x 2.34m). Side aspect double glazed window with views to Beeston Bump in the Distance, Velux roof light window , radiator, spot lighting and television point.

bathroom9'7" x 8' (2.92m x 2.44m). Suite comprising double ended bath with central tap inset into a tiled marble frame work, sink set on a marble tiled base, low level WC, tiled shower cubicle, underfloor heating, double glazed window, heated towel rail and extractor fan.

OUTSIDE The front of the property is accessed via a shared driveway to the side of the Cromer Road Stores, leading to a five bar gate with private drive leading to the detached double garage and large paved patio area, A Pergola opens onto the main garden which has an outside tap, lawned areas and various flower and shrub displays, two decked seating areas and a secret garden with a small herb and fruit garden.

Double garage18' x 16'8" (5.49m x 5.08m). Electric remote control roller door, courtesy door and side facing window, there is a work bench, power and light with stairs to the first floor which is boarded and has three Velux roof lights.
